- [ ] Step 7: Archive cold storage buckets (Glacierline tier). Confirm both ceremony witnesses are present, verify bucket manifests match the Oxbow ledger, then seal the archive key shares. Plugin authors may observe but not handle shares. Once sealed, the archive index itself is encrypted and can only be reopened with the passphrase below.

vault phrase of badup-hahig = tamael-aldael-kelmir-istael-fenok-istwyn-tamius-jorath-oliion

Document Transport — Print Shop Master Copies

Quick guide for moving master copies to Bramblehurst Print Co. These are the only originals, so treat the run like a valuables transfer, not a regular parcel drop. Use the red tamper-evident envelopes from the supply shelf, log the seal number in the transport book, and never combine the run with general mail. The masters go directly to the press supervisor, nobody else. On arrival, the courier must follow the hand-over instruction stated below.

drop instructions, kajep-tageg: the kasvan casdor courier leaves the quenvan quenox druox ledger at gate 4316 under passcode 799004

## Deploying the Gatewick Proctor Queue

Deploys are pretty painless: push to main, wait for the pipeline, then watch the queue drain dashboard for five minutes. If candidates pile up mid-exam, roll back first and ask questions later — the queue replays safely. Everything the workers care about lives in one config block, shown here for reference.

settings of bafof-yagef:
JOROX_PIN=8740
JOROX_TENANT=pelox
JOROX_METRICS_HOST=metrics.jorox.qorvelworks.internal
JOROX_SEAL=seal_c78f63c1
JOROX_STANDBY_TEAM=norax